Nigerian billionaire Aliko Dangote, Africa’s richest person, fell 25 places on the Bloomberg Billionaires Index on Monday as the naira tumbled on its first day of trading without a peg to the U.S. dollar.

Dangote’s fortune fell $3.7 billion, knocking him to No. 71 on the Bloomberg ranking, down from No. 46 on Friday. The majority of Dangote’s $12.7 billion fortune is derived from a 91 percent stake in Dangote Cement Plc, which shed 2 percent in trading Monday.
